How to buy walrus?
It’s easy and secure to buy the Walrus cryptocurrency online through a regulated platform, even as a beginner. You can choose between two main methods: buying Walrus on the spot market (you own the coins directly), or trading Walrus via crypto CFDs (you speculate on the price without holding the asset). Each method has its own advantages and risks. If you’d like to compare trusted platforms and their fees, scroll down—our full comparative guide is available further below on this page.
Buying Walrus on the Spot Market
Buying Walrus “on the spot” means you directly purchase and own the actual Walrus coins, which are then stored in your account or crypto wallet. This method is popular with investors who want full control and long-term exposure to Walrus. Fees typically consist of a flat commission per transaction, usually ranging from 0.5% to 1.5% depending on the platform, deducted in your local currency (CAD).
Example
Suppose the current price of Walrus is $5 CAD per coin. With a $1,000 CAD purchase, and around $5 in trading fees, you can buy about 199 Walrus coins.
✔️ Profit scenario:
If the price of Walrus rises by 10%, your 199 coins are now worth $1,100 CAD.
Result: That’s a gross gain of $100 CAD, or +10% on your initial investment.
Trading Walrus via CFD
Trading Walrus via CFD (Contract for Difference) means you speculate on Walrus’s price movements, without owning the actual coins. CFDs are designed for short-term trades and let you use leverage—potentially magnifying gains or losses. Fees include the spread (difference between buy and sell price) and, if the position stays overnight, a daily financing fee.
Example
You open a CFD position on Walrus with $1,000 CAD and 5x leverage. Your market exposure equals $5,000 CAD.
✔️ Profit scenario:
If Walrus gains 8%, your position gains 8% × 5 = 40%.
Result: That’s a $400 CAD profit on your $1,000 CAD investment (excluding fees).

What tax rules apply to capital gains on cryptocurrencies in Canada, and is Walrus concerned?
In Canada, capital gains from the sale or exchange of cryptocurrencies like Walrus are taxable—half of the realized capital gain is included in your taxable income. This applies whether you convert Walrus to Canadian dollars or another token. Crypto transactions must be clearly declared in your annual tax filing, and no specific exemption exists for Walrus. Be sure to maintain detailed records of all your crypto activities for accurate reporting.
